Published Saturday, March 10, 2001 - Chanute, KS

Grace Agnes Brazil, 88, died Friday, March 9, 2001, at Lakepoint Nursing Home in Rose Hill, Kansas.

She was born Aug. 28, 1912, in St. Paul, Kansas, the daughter of W.W. and Grace May O'Bryan.

She graduated from Webster University in St. Louis, MO, and received her nursing degree from St. Louis University.

She married William A. "Bill" Brazil in St. Paul in 1940, and he preceded her in death.

She practiced and taught nursing all her life.

She was also preceded by an infant son, Charles Edward; seven brothers; and two sisters.

She is survived by three sons, Tom of Yates Center, KS, Paul of Chanute, KS, and Michael of Parkville, MO; four daughters, Jean Bilgere of Richardson, TX, Fran Hawley of Andover, TX, Lorean Ruggles of Scottsdale, AZ, and Janet Williams of Carthage, MO; a brother, John O'Bryan of Altamont, KS; 23 grandchildren; and 14 great-grandchildren.

Funeral Mass will be at St. Patrick's Catholic Church, Chanute, KS, Monday. Burial will follow at St. Patrick's Cemetery, Chanute, Kansas.

Gibson-Koch-Friskel Chapel is in charge of arrangements.
